My advice to you would be to take it slow, taking cover in every advancement. In combat evolved, slow and steady does indeed win the race, with the exception of the library, where your best means of survival is to book it out of there the best you can.

Also, it might be a good idea to keep your rocket ammo in "The Silent Cartographer" to the end, and use your pistol on the hunters, "one-shotting" them in the back where it is orange. This ammo is saved for the yellow "shipmaster" elite at the very ending. (He's a pain in the neck otherwise.)

Useful tips:

-Plasma Rifles cause enemies to flinch, use this to your advantage.

-Needlers destroy elites (if you have a clear shot).

-If an elite takes a swing at you I am almost certain it will kill you in one hit on legendary. Counter this by dodging and then looping around for the assassination.

-When fighting hunters close-range always strafe to the left.

-Sniper rifles don't harm the flood.

-Plasma pistols are a very useful weapon if you are low on ammo (you can find them anywhere).

-Don't rely much on your marines unless they are armed with a sniper or they are in a warthog turret.

-Plasma Grenades are best used to take out elites. Stick = Dead Covy.

-CE Pistol destroys everything. I assume you already know this.

-Sentinels are easily dispatched with Plasma Rifles.

-Never ditch your sniper on Truth and Reconciliation.

the plasma pistol the pistol are your best friends. charged pp bolt to take out an elites shield then head shot.

shot a jackal in the foot or the notch in its shield to break his stance then head shot or stick him if he's near other enemies. you can find them tricky at times so use a charged pp bolt on their shield if they waste too much of your ammo

do not fear the hunters, one of the easiest enemies in the game to kill when you get use to engaging them. when you seen one run towards him, he will then run towards you and try to melee you. dodge him then a single pistol/sniper shot to his orange, fleshy core will kill him.

sentinels can be a challenge so a charged pp bolt, take cover. suprise it with your AR, shotgun or pistol.

floods are the most lethal enemies imo. they will use rocket launchers no matter how close you are. shotgun wielding ones can suprise you if you come across one from the corner vice versa. use bullets and needlers to kill flood. sniper rifles are useless against them for some reason, shotgun works well, pistol and AR is decent. flood are immune to melee attacks. avoid shooting or getting near carrier forms as best as you can, the infectious forms are annoying and "size effective"

Unless he has a sniper rifle or chaingun a marine is useless.
Learn to DRIVE(if you get hung up on terrain you aren't a driver) the Warthog. With a gunner you are unbeatable. On Halo(the level) spend as much time as possible behind the wheel. Your bumper and chaingunner should do 90% of the work.

Stealth on AotCR will bag you sleeping grunts and elites that walk pretty predictable paths. A gun butt to the back of the head saves ammo. Oh yeah, follow the ARROWs.
Try to get in a position where you start every firefight with a sticky or two tossed at unsuspecting elites. Don't use stickys on Flood. With practice you can tag incoming Banshee's.
Hunters are weak. The closer you are the safer. Learn to backpedal and then gut shoot them.
The Needler destroys elites.
The Plasma Rifle has a stun effect that slows your enemy's reaction and allows you to strafe close enough to whack them when you start to overheat. With practice you can do the same with the AR. It lacks the stun, but is pretty easy to do on red and blue elites. Goldilox not so much. Shoot the AR in short bursts. Saves ammo and is much more accurate.

Plasma Pistol is the most useful weapon in the game. The OC shot flies perfectly straight for a looong distance. Learn to use it with the M-6D.
Rocket launcher and sniper are great, but dragging them along limits your tactical flexability. You can take out a Wraith with the pistol if you have to.
Caution is fine, but there are times when uber aggression gets you into enemy spawn points and you can wreak havoc on an unprepared enemy. Try ditching the Scorpion for the Warthog on AotCR. I've driven over entire spawns in the corridor of the tower that houses the active camo. Use the Overshield on PoA and charge up that staircase immediately. At the top you are in position to frag and sticky your enemies before they can exit the bulkhead doors.

Invisible elites are best taken on with the AR. Its poor accuracy helps light them up and their shields are pretty weak in the first place.

Belly of the Beast is the hardest thing ever. Watch your radar and time a sticky to go off just as the doors open. Pay attention to the beeps. Sniper the elites, and use your precious frags for a door full of grunts or Jackals. Be aggressive and recover stickys as a priortiy. When things go bad, grab the active camo and whack powerful enemies in the back.
